Output 8bd8f8012b51f61c2486c92ade7e20adb85315c4bd44906acd4fc6c64725eb62:4

value
367582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ab0e5708875f548d7b4a69e8306e0ad80a0ab7 OP_EQUAL
address
3B3smHpRcaxF8BRheB15tBzQoEZDazo6tc
transaction
8bd8f8012b51f61c2486c92ade7e20adb85315c4bd44906acd4fc6c64725eb62
confirmations
192622
spent
true